Antique Italian Pair of Roman Cointhian Style Carved & Giltwood Pedestals

About the Item

An Italian pair of carved and giltwood three feet tall pedestals from the early 20th century. This antique pair of architectural pedestal columns from Italy, standing approximately three feet in height, are gesso and gilt over wood. The round-shaped and fluted shafts have flattened tops and bottoms ornate with hand-carved, curled acanthus leaf motif details typical Roman Corinthian fashion. The gold gilt finish is enhanced by a wonderful patina, warmth about the leaves, and great chippy bits. These antique Italian Corinthian pedestals, with their smooth and flat tops, are ready to display your perfectly potted plants, or sculptural works of art within your home.
